IN PERSON | TAKING PLACE AT THE APOLLO STAGES AT THE VICTORIA THEATERIn collaboration with the Apollo Theater, join us for an evening featuring scene readings and poetry drawn from the expansive Harlem-based theater artist and writer Gwendolen Hardwick. A dynamic performer, visionary theater maker, and devoted community organizer, Hardwick, for over four decades, has helped shape and sustain vital creative spaces for Black and queer women writers and performers in New York.
Additionally, experience excerpts of performances by Dominique Morisseau, LaVonda Elam, NSangou Njikam, and Claro de los Reyes, all of whom have studied under Hardwick's mentorship. The evening will culminate with a conversation, moderated by director, playwright and actor Kevin R. Free.
